Topic 3: Free-time activities is a core part of the AQA GCSE Spanish syllabus, covering how to talk about hobbies, sports, music, TV, cinema, and eating out. This topic is essential because it allows you to express personal preferences and opinions, which are key to achieving high marks in speaking and writing exams. You'll learn vocabulary for common activities, opinion phrases, and how to use the present tense to describe what you do in your free time. Mastering this topic also helps you connect with Spanish-speaking cultures, as many free-time activities reflect cultural habits, such as going out for tapas or playing football.
In the exam, you may be asked to describe your hobbies, compare them with others, or discuss plans for future free-time activities. This topic builds on basic verbs like 'jugar' (to play) and 'hacer' (to do), and introduces more complex structures such as 'me gusta + infinitive' and 'prefiero + noun/infinitive'. You'll also learn to use adverbs of frequency (e.g., 'a menudo', 'nunca') and time phrases (e.g., 'los fines de semana', 'por la tarde'). Understanding this topic is crucial for the speaking and writing exams, where you need to give extended answers with opinions and justifications.
Free-time activities also link to other topics like 'Home, town, neighbourhood and region' (e.g., where you do activities) and 'Customs and festivals' (e.g., special events). By the end of this topic, you should be able to hold a conversation about your leisure time, using a range of vocabulary and tenses.
